Transaction 61146deb818c26b5108c1d9f6139de0a8a99b4c375739b2fad809dc2f696ff3b

1 Input
2 Outputs
  • 61146deb818c26b5108c1d9f6139de0a8a99b4c375739b2fad809dc2f696ff3b:0
  • value  4318000
    address  32MSaEUqJMCdYE9mFecVCzpxFdgCsqvkmC
  • 61146deb818c26b5108c1d9f6139de0a8a99b4c375739b2fad809dc2f696ff3b:1
  • value  178136365
    address  32e3S2tams1MZeWHXGV3vmXuLetCBH2Y2i